Description

Overview Position: Physical Therapist (PT) Location: Cincinnati, OH & Ft. Thomas, KY Schedule: Full Time - Split Hospital Coverage for Cincinnati Downtown, Cincinnati North & Northern Kentucky Compensation: $32.00 to $50.00 per Hour, Based off of Experience ***Must have active license in KY and OH*** Select Specialty Hospital - Cincinnati Hospitals & Northern Kentucky is a critical illness recovery hospital committed to providing world-class inpatient post-ICU services to chronic, critically ill patients who require extended healing and recovery. We help patients during some of the most vulnerable, painful moments of their lives – and Physical Therapists (PT) play a central role in providing compassionate, excellent treatment every step of the way. Why Join Us: Start Strong : Extensive and thorough Physical Therapist (PT) orientation program to ensure a smooth transition into our setting. Advance Your Career : Tuition reimbursement, and continuing education opportunities. Elevate Your Skills : Clinical ladder program. Ease the Burden : Student debt benefit program. Your Health Matters : Comprehensive medical/RX, health, vision, and dental plan offerings Recharge & Refresh: Generous PTO to maintain a healthy work-life balance Invest in Your Future: Company-matching 401(k) retirement plan, as well as life and disability protection Your Impact Matters: Join a team of over 44,000 nationwide committed to providing exceptional care. Responsibilities Performing initial and ongoing systematic patient assessment. Promoting continuous quality improvement. Teaching and counseling patients/families. Setting goals and developing treatment plans. Working cooperatively to identify and solve patient-specific and facility-wide needs. Participating in discharge planning for each patient, including placement, patient/family education and adaptive equipment. Supervising Physical Therapy Assistants, as well as supervising PT and PTA students. Conducting individual patient therapy regimens. Monitoring patient's response to treatment and modifying treatment during sessions, as needed. Completing appropriate documentation according to department policies and procedures. Participating in departmental, hospital, and community continuing education seminars and in-services. Qualifications Minimum Qualifications Current state licensure as a Physical Therapist required. Certified BLS or completion in first 90 days of employment required. Additional Data Equal Opportunity Employer/including Disabled/Veterans
